Job Description
We are seeking an experienced etch engineer to drive CVD process development. The ideal candidate would also have some experience with non-RIE dry chemical etch systems (Selectra®, SiCoNi or similar systems) but this is not required.
Key responsibilities:
- Develop CVD processes from initial conception for new integrations, through product prototyping, and finally providing manufacturable solutions to the production organization.
- Develop new CVD processes and techniques to solve novel integration problems. Drive solutions that are cost effective and manufacturable.
- Develop and apply innovative techniques to characterize CVD hardware and aid in the ongoing development of CVD hardware for a range of applications, within safety guidelines.
- Design experiments, collect and analyze data, and compile reports on significantly complex process engineering experiments for a range of processes and products.
- Train junior CVD engineers on how to effectively define and implement new methodologies, define and apply new technologies, and/or troubleshoot and resolve significantly complex process engineering issues/problems for a range of processes, integrations, and products
- Work in a collaborative R&D environment with individuals from different disciplines and/or business units.
- Interact with key customers to resolve significantly complex process engineering issues for a range of products to address our customers High Value Problems (HVP)
- Generate internal and external documentation for products, presentations, technical reports for integrated products and generate process engineering specifications for integrated products.
